In an older home, drafts are prevalent around doors and windows. By strategically applying weather-stripping and caulking to close these gaps, homeowners can eliminate drafts, conserve energy, and enhance indoor comfort efficiently.
During home renovations, addressing air leaks in the attic can drastically improve overall energy efficiency. Proper insulation combined with sealing overlooked gaps around joists and vents ensures minimal heat loss and reduces energy bills.
For newly installed HVAC systems, ensuring that air ducts are properly sealed prevents conditioned air from escaping. This not only maintains optimal temperatures but also significantly cuts down on energy costs by preventing unnecessary machinery overuse.
